Output 3dc099069be3a0ab77934c33ad99ccd87b111d60db48c1c8e31b7f8d08517541:19

value
473586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5a0adfa38fd57988ab9f671141f39a1ce501b2 OP_EQUAL
address
3JrvpsLbtKPVsPtegxSEs4Aa6jM9ppT1Y3
transaction
3dc099069be3a0ab77934c33ad99ccd87b111d60db48c1c8e31b7f8d08517541
spent
true